Output 5741f40732361c717b5d773930fbeaa2b91f40407c27c177dffcf97d0cc78c5a:0

value
3321876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5894969d45dd62046be8d66d1d6d19a3a9b70b9 OP_EQUAL
address
3KhVWBmQ6L6D5iGDX4pejbiWfRMrCoyGx4
transaction
5741f40732361c717b5d773930fbeaa2b91f40407c27c177dffcf97d0cc78c5a
confirmations
269800
spent
true